Shipping industry points to more Asian economic weakness


SINGAPORE: Steep drops in Asian shipping rates are adding to fears about slowing trade, as a fall in export orders from countries across the region depresses demand for ships carrying 90 percent of world trade.

Although shipping rates also reflect sector-specific factors such as vessel orders and seasonal demand swings, analysts say they can act as a bellwhether of global trade given that the vast majority of goods are transported by ship.
